About Longwood, Fl Longwood prides itself on remaining a family oriented community, despite its growth over the years. The area encompasses several country club developments as well as more moderately priced homes for families just starting out. Longwood is the address for many of the upscale neighborhoods off Markham Woods Road as well as the golf communities of Sweetwater Oaks, Sabal Point, and Wekiva; all highly sought after because of the established neighborhoods, amenities, and excellent schools.
Historic Longwood is located in the heart of Central Florida less than 30 miles from world-renowned Walt Disney World and Universal Studios. About 14,500 Longwood residents enjoy a safe, comfortable, family-friendly atmosphere, moderately priced homes and proximity to the dynamic Orlando Metro area. Longwood is one of seven cities centrally located in Seminole County, one of the fastest growing counties in the state. Longwood offers access to a number of outstanding natural recreational opportunities. Residents enjoy canoe trips down the lazy Wekiva River; hiking, biking and jogging on trails through lush forests; and golfing on the area’s many challenging courses.
The community’s family-oriented atmosphere is complemented by the outstanding local school system. Longwood students are served by Seminole County Public Schools, a district that consistently rates as the best in the state and among the top 100 in the nation. The county’s 63,000 students have the highest test scores in the region and also score significantly higher than the national average on standardized college-entry exams. Longwood especially prides itself on its country club housing developments, which capitalize on the area’s natural bounty. A wide variety of single-family homes can be found in charming historic and elegant country club neighborhoods. Many affordable condominiums and townhouses are also available.
